The QDB series is a sanitary grade Dry Blender launched by Q-Pumps (Queretaro, Mexico). It is a modular online mixing system consisting of QIM online mixer, worktable, and hopper (including built-in ball valve). The core is used for dry mixing and online mixing of powder liquid and powder powder, suitable for hygiene conditions such as food, beverage, pharmaceutical, cosmetics, etc46Core certifications include 3A, FDA, EHEDG, fluid contact surface standard Ra ≤ 0.8 μ m (32 μ in), optional Ra ≤ 0.4 μ m (16 μ in) electropolishing, standard 304/316L stainless steel material, compatible with NEMA/IEC motors, 50/60Hz universal, can be upgraded with QVM high viscosity mixer and QTS twin-screw pump combination6.

Food and beverage: milk powder/whey powder dissolution, protein powder mixing, beverage powder/juice powder compounding, jam/syrup added powder ingredients;
Pharmaceutics and cosmetics: dissolution of pharmaceutical powder, dispersion of powder in ointment/lotion, mixing of cosmetic powder and base material;
Other: Mixing of powder catalysts with liquid media in fine chemicals, and chemical dissolution in CIP/SIP cleaning processes.

Maintenance points
Avoid idling and prevent wear on the rotor and cavity;
Regularly check the sealing of the ball valve and the clearance between the mixing rotor and the cavity;
Select rotor type based on powder particle size, mixing ratio, and viscosity to extend service life;
Spare parts have strong universality, and vulnerable parts such as rotors and seals can be quickly replaced.
